A short history of medical genetics /
Peter S. Harper.
- Oxford ; New York : Oxford University Press, 2008.
- xi, 557 p. : ill., maps ; 25 cm.
- Oxford monographs on medical genetics ; 57 .
Includes bibliographical references (p. 501-538) and index.
Before Mendel -- Mendelism and human inherited disease -- The rise of classical genetics -- The beginnings of molecular biology -- Human chromosomes -- Human biochemical genetics -- The human gene map -- Genes, populations, and human inherited disease -- Human genetics as a scientific discipline -- From human to medical genetics -- The elements of medical genetics -- Medical genetics : the laboratory basis -- Human molecular genetics -- The management, treatment, and prevention of genetic disease -- Eugenics -- The tragedy of Russian genetics -- Medical genetics : the ethical dimension -- History in the making.
